Output 6afdaddae71af9f12dca6e2421499c46144e20394395941957f2084db9599e18:8

value
155834554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2855a370a355dd0ffa92834b83a91687d5d6ef OP_EQUAL
address
MQxkuo2fVAsBTu4TeYaru7Q9KYjKpUveBg
transaction
6afdaddae71af9f12dca6e2421499c46144e20394395941957f2084db9599e18
spent
true